CITY OF ARLINGTON CENSUS 2000 :: SUPPLEMENTARY SURVEY

Census 2000 Supplementary Survey LogoIn May, 2002, the Census Bureau released the Census 2000 Supplementary Survey (C2SS) information. The Census 2000 Supplementary Survey is a Decennial Census program designed to demonstrate the feasibility of collecting long form type information at the same time as, but separate from, the Decennial Census. It used the questionnaire and methods developed for the American Community Survey to collect demographic, social, economic, and housing data from a national sample of 700,000 households. To read more about the Census 2000 Supplementary Survey and how to use this data, visit the U.S. Census Bureau C2SS web-site. The results for the city of Arlington are listed in four tables:
